A bit about us, and how we’re different
Digital Disruptions is a boutique US-based strategy and design innovation consulting firm focusing on fintech and digital financial services (DFS) in emerging markets. Since our founding in 2014, we’ve been re-thinking – and re-doing – the way fintech consulting work is done. [Read more about our unique traits].
Our mission is to apply and adapt best-in-class innovation tools, methods, and mindsets to the fintech sector, and work diligently yet swiftly from research and design to build and launch phases.
We take a start-up style approach that fuses analytical and creative thinking and use our proprietary frameworks and workflows we have developed in-house. The result is tangible progress for our clients – and meaningful impact for the people and communities they serve.
We’ve been trusted by top-tier clients in both the private sector (Amazon Web Services, Vodafone M-Pesa, Mastercard, Ecobank, BRAC Microfinance, VC-backed start-ups) and public domain (e.g., World Bank, IFC, International Monetary Fund, United Nations, World Economic Forum). What we’re looking for
We’re seeking an Africa-based Gender Advisor who will work with us on a project basis. The successful candidate will be an expert in gender studies and up to date with the latest thinking and research. They will advise the team and stakeholders how to incorporate gender-intentional frameworks in designing fintech products and services, particularly those serving underbanked and unbanked consumers and businesses. The Gender Advisor will also have an understanding of the intersectionality of gender and other underrepresented segments, such as low income individuals, visibility minorities, rural populations, youth, and migrants.
The role is both internally facing (i.e. mentoring and advising the team during projects) as well as externally facing (i.e. supporting our clients in need of gender expertise). You should have a passion for social impact, fintech, and a fascination with emerging markets. On one hand, you should be proactive and self-motivated to work independently; on the other, you’ll work collaboratively with cross-functional teams in different time zones. Most importantly, we are looking for someone who is both a thinker and doer, with a strong bias to execution.
